Emergency Water Extraction
When a storm causes water to flood your home, every minute counts. Our team will arrive quickly to extract the water and prevent further damage. This is a critical step in the storm damage restoration process, as standing water can lead to mold growth, structural issues, and costly repairs.
Structural Drying Process
After water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your home’s structure. This involves using powerful fans and dehumidifiers to remove moisture from walls, floors, and ceilings. Our goal is to prevent mold growth and structural issues, while also reducing the risk of further damage.
Mold Inspection and Testing
Mold growth is a common issue after a storm, especially in areas with high humidity. Our team will inspect your home for signs of mold and conduct testing to find out the extent of the problem. This is a critical step in the storm damage restoration process, as mold can cause serious health issues and damage to your home’s structure.

Storm Damage Restoration Cost in the 98093 Area
The cost of storm dam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and other local factors. Our team will work closely with you to understand your budget and develop a customized plan that meets your needs and budget.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Structural Drying Process |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ials damaged |
| Mold Inspection and Testing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old present |
| Sewage Cleanup |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ials damaged |
| Basement Flood Recovery |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ials damaged |
| Post-Remediation Verification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ials damaged |
